Discover the Power of In-Person Learning: arol.dev Coding Bootcamp in Barcelona

Discover the Power of In-Person Learning: arol.dev Coding Bootcamp in Barcelona
Discover the Power of In-Person Learning: arol.dev Coding Bootcamp in Barcelona
Discover the Power of In-Person Learning: arol.dev Coding Bootcamp in Barcelona

The shift toward online education has made learning more accessible than ever, especially in fields like coding and software development. However, while many bootcamps have closed their doors or gone fully remote, arol.dev remains committed to the power of face-to-face mentorship, real-world collaboration, and a supportive learning community. This raises an important question: Is online learning enough, or does in-person education offer an edge that’s hard to replicate?

In this article, we’ll explore the advantages and disadvantages of in-person and online learning, helping you decide which format suits your goals, learning style, and career aspirations. We’ll also highlight how arol.dev combines the best of both worlds to deliver a transformative coding education in Barcelona.

Online Learning: Flexibility Meets Self-Discipline

Online learning offers unparalleled flexibility, allowing students to learn at their own pace, from anywhere in the world. Platforms like MOOCs (massive open online courses) and online bootcamps make coding education more accessible, particularly for those with busy schedules or tight budgets.

Advantages of Online Learning

  1. Accessibility: Learn from the comfort of your home, without the need to relocate or commute.

  2. Affordability: Many online courses are cost-effective, with free or low-cost options for beginners.

  3. Self-Paced Learning: Ideal for independent learners who thrive on managing their schedules.

Challenges of Online Learning

  1. Lack of Direct Interaction: Online programs often lack the personal touch of face-to-face mentorship, which can slow down support and limit meaningful peer collaboration.

  2. Isolation: Many learners struggle with the absence of a collaborative environment, leading to feelings of detachment.

  3. Limited Networking Opportunities: Building valuable industry connections can be challenging in online-only environments.

  4. Over-Reliance on Self-Discipline: Online learning demands significant self-motivation to maintain progress.

In-Person Learning: Building Skills Through Connection

In-person learning, on the other hand, offers an immersive environment where students can collaborate, engage, and receive immediate feedback. This format prioritizes community, hands-on guidance, and networking opportunities, all of which are critical for aspiring developers aiming to break into the industry.

Advantages of In-Person Learning

  1. Face-to-Face Mentorship: Direct access to instructors ensures personalized guidance and immediate feedback on projects and concepts.

  2. Collaborative Environment: Work closely with peers, fostering teamwork and creative problem-solving skills.

  3. Industry Networking: Being part of a physical tech ecosystem opens doors to meetups, job fairs, and professional connections.

Challenges of In-Person Learning

  1. Location and Cost: Requires a commitment to be present at a specific location, which might mean higher costs for relocation or tuition.

  2. Schedule Constraints: Fixed schedules may not suit those juggling work, family, or other responsibilities.

  3. Environment Comfort: While in-person learning offers structure and focus, it may lack the comfort of studying at home, where learners can create their ideal environment to enhance concentration and ease.

A Balanced Approach: What Sets arol.dev Apart?

For students seeking the best of both worlds, arol.dev offers a hybrid learning model that combines the personal connections of in-person learning with the flexibility of remote education. Our unique approach ensures that no matter where you are, you can access the same level of mentorship, hands-on projects, and community support.

Why arol.dev?

  1. Hybrid Learning Model

    Whether you’re joining us on campus in Barcelona or learning remotely from anywhere, arol.dev prioritizes a remote-first experience. Our online students receive the same immersive, learning environment as those on-site, with live sessions, personalized real-time feedback, and seamless collaboration.


  2. Mentorship-First Philosophy

    Our instructors are not just teachers, but dedicated mentors who guide you through every stage of your learning journey, adjusting their approach based on your individual needs and goals. We help students stay on track and achieve their goals.


  3. Hands-On, Real-World Projects

    From day one, you’ll work on coding assignments that replicate industry challenges, ensuring you graduate with job-ready skills. We host interactive sessions, ensuring students stay motivated and connected.


  4. Thriving Tech Community in Barcelona

    Our base at Norrsken House places students in the heart of a vibrant tech hub, where they can access startup resources, meet-ups, and networking opportunities, whether they’re learning in person or remotely. Also, our network extends beyond the program.

At arol.dev, we believe that education isn’t one-size-fits-all. Our program is designed to help students discover their potential, whether they’re starting their first tech job or advancing their career.

“I realized early on that traditional education doesn’t always translate to real-world tech skills. At arol.dev, we focus on bridging that gap, teaching you not only how to code but how to solve the kinds of problems real developers face every day.” - Arol

At arol.dev, you’re part of a dynamic learning community, in-person or online. The students work closely with each other on projects, forming connections that continue into their careers. You’re not just learning to code, you’re building a professional network.

And when the challenges do arise, our instructors are right there to help. You get instant feedback, can ask questions in real-time, and collaborate directly with peers to tackle tough coding problems together, whether you are joining online or on campus.

The curriculum at arol.dev emphasizes real-world projects over theory. From day one, you work on coding assignments and team-based projects designed to mirror the work you would do on the job. Our curriculum focuses on technologies that are in high demand, including Javascript, Typescript, React, Docker, Git, CI/CD, Testing, Cloud technologies, and more. Students graduate equipped with practical skills that employers value.

Why Barcelona? The Perfect Place for Learning and Networking

Choosing where you study is just as important as how you study. Barcelona offers an inspiring mix of innovation, culture, and opportunity, making it a top choice for aspiring developers. At arol.dev, we’re proud to be part of this exciting ecosystem, and that our home base is in Norrsken House, a renowned hub for tech, entrepreneurship, and social impact.

Key Benefits of Learning in Barcelona

  1. Access to a Thriving Tech Scene: Home to global startups, tech events, and conferences, Barcelona is a hub for innovation and entrepreneurship.

  2. Networking Opportunities: Being part of this community allows you to meet potential mentors, collaborators, and employers.

  3. A City That Inspires: From the beaches to its historic architecture, Barcelona is the perfect backdrop for balancing rigorous study with quality of life.

Learning to code in this dynamic environment offers you opportunities galore. You’ll be part of a city buzzing with talent, able to attend tech meet-ups, visit startups, and network with professionals who could become your future mentors, colleagues, or employers.

Making Your Decision: Online or In-Person?

The decision between online and in-person learning depends on your individual needs and goals. For those who value structure, mentorship, and real-world collaboration, learning with arol.dev offers the support needed to excel, whether in person or online. But don’t only trust our words, watch the following testimonials from our students.


"Transitioning to IT through arol.dev was a transformative journey for me. The program was challenging but incredibly rewarding, with supportive instructors and a collaborative community that kept me motivated. Today, I’m thriving as a developer, thanks to the hands-on skills and lifelong connections I built during the program." - Hrvoje



"Joining arol.dev was a life-changing experience for me. The program didn’t just teach me how to code; it taught me how to think and solve problems like a developer, with invaluable support from instructors and peers. Today, I confidently work as a front-end developer, and I’m grateful for the skills, unity, and opportunities the program provided." - Agnes

Ready to Start Your Coding Journey with arol.dev?

Choosing the right learning path, whether in-person or online, can be a tough decision. Both formats offer distinct advantages, from the flexibility of online learning to the collaborative and immersive environment of in-person education. At arol.dev, we provide the best of both worlds, with a hybrid learning model designed to support every student's needs, wherever they are.

We understand that what works for one person may not work for another, which is why our approach is centered around flexibility, mentorship, and hands-on, real-world experience. Whether you decide to learn in Barcelona or remotely, we ensure that you receive personalized guidance, access to a supportive community, and the practical skills that will help you succeed in the tech industry.

Take the first step today. Book a call with us to discuss which is the best option for you or come visit us on campus in person anytime!

© AROLDEV, SLU 2024

© AROLDEV, SLU 2024

© AROLDEV, SLU 2024